Massachusetts Governor’s Deputy Director Arrested on Drug and Gun Charges

LaMar Cook, the Western Massachusetts Deputy Director for the Healey administration, was arrested for trafficking over 200 grams of cocaine, with authorities seizing approximately 21 kilograms in total during the investigation, which involved multiple prior seizures and a controlled delivery operation. Cook has been terminated from his position, and the investigation is ongoing.

Massachusetts City Tops US Housing Market Rankings

Springfield, Massachusetts, known as the birthplace of basketball, has been named the hottest housing market in the US for the first time in seven years, according to Realtor.com. The city has seen a surge in demand due to its proximity to Boston, with homes selling faster and attracting more views than the national average. Despite a 4.3% increase in home prices over the past year, Springfield remains more affordable than the national average, making it attractive for buyers with flexible work arrangements. The trend highlights the appeal of affordability-driven markets in the Northeast and Midwest.

Springfield's Complex Relationship with Trump Amid Immigration Controversy

Springfield, Ohio, a focal point during the 2024 presidential election due to false claims by Trump about Haitian immigrants, is grappling with uncertainty following Trump's victory. Residents express mixed feelings of hope and fear, particularly concerning potential mass deportations promised by Trump. The Haitian community, which has significantly contributed to the local economy, faces anxiety over their future status. Local leaders and residents are cautiously planning their next steps while hoping to move past the negative attention and continue economic growth.

Springfield Officer Shot, 7 Arrested in Chaotic Crime Spree

A Springfield police officer is recovering from serious gunshot wounds to the face and leg after being attacked by suspects in two separate vehicles during a series of shootings on Wednesday night. The officer, a seven-year veteran and Medal of Valor recipient, has been transferred to a Boston hospital for treatment. Multiple suspects have been arrested, and several firearms have been seized. The Springfield Police Department remains committed to their duties while supporting the injured officer and his family.

"Springfield's Solar Eclipse: Viewing Parties and Public Health Advisory"

The City of Springfield has issued a Public Health Advisory ahead of Monday's solar eclipse, urging residents to protect their eyes and avoid looking at the sun without special ISO standard glasses. The Health & Human Services Commissioner emphasized the importance of eye safety and cautioned against using cameras, telescopes, or binoculars without solar filters. Residents are advised to avoid distracted driving and not to wear eclipse glasses while driving.

"Springfield City Utilities Urges Voluntary Power Conservation from Customers"

Springfield's City Utilities is asking customers to voluntarily conserve power due to extreme cold temperatures impacting the delivery of natural gas along the pipeline, potentially creating supply issues through Tuesday. Customers are requested to limit non-essential appliance use, lower thermostats, minimize heating and lighting in unoccupied rooms, and postpone major energy-consuming activities. The utility's system is not expected to have problems, but the issue stems from the natural gas supplier, and crews are on standby in case of service disruptions.
